Sec. 522.23 Acepromazine.

(a) Specifications. Each milliliter of solution contains 10 milligrams (mg) acepromazine maleate.

(b) Sponsors. See Nos. 000010 and 058198 in § 510.600(c) of this chapter.

(c) Conditions of use in dogs, cats, and horses - (1) Amount. Dogs: 0.25 to 0.5 mg per pound (/lb) of body weight; Cats: 0.5 to 1.0 mg/lb of body weight; Horses: 2.0 to 4.0 mg per 100 lbs of body weight.

(2) Indications for use. For use as a tranquilizer and as a preanesthetic agent.

(3) Limitations. Do not use in horses intended for human consumption. Federal law restricts this drug to use by or on the order of a licensed veterinarian.
